Senior Director, Insights & Analytics Centre of Excellence

1. Setup the overall service level agreement of the Center of Excellence in partnership with the other finance leaders

2. Lead & continuously improve the dashboard & Analytics group which role is to

  • Maintain, run, enhance transformed Dashboards/Reports (monthly P&L packages etc.) to support finance operations
  • Perform associated analysis/insights on transformed data sets/models
  • Maintain reporting standards & definitions
  • Enhance & evolve quality of commentary & insights

3. Lead & continuously improve the product management group “Front Office” which role is to

  • Act as the liaison between Finance, Technology & the dashboard and analytics group to manage & continuously improve product processes and enabling technologies
  • Manage workflow & operational processes
  • Monitor performance of models and application based on customer experience
  • Own the support of One Stream models and supporting analytical products
  • Communicate backlog of enhancements and ensure prioritization

4. Lead the Master Data management capacity for Walmart Canada which role is to

  • Execute data decisions and maintain FP&A data elements, hierarchies, dimensions, metrics and reference data. Resolve master data issues as they arise
  • Govern financial master data and metric definitions for financial reporting and planning models & analyze/communicate any change impacts
  • Partner with business data lead/owners on MDM transformation journeys & Ensure changes cascade to all downstream tools/systems

5. Lead the newly created Data Science capability in market which role is to

  • Owns the ongoing maintenance of data science models built during transformation
  • Refreshes data, adds/tweaks drivers and ensures models improve over time
  • Demonstrate the value created by applied predictive analytic models to relevant financial datasets

6. Recruit, coach and develop a talented team providing proactive mentoring. Also ensure building future succession within the team

7. Drive associate engagement by valuing associates, listening, and responding to concerns, recognizing, and rewarding accomplishments and providing opportunities for growth and development.

Position Summary…

“The Sr Director for Analytics and Insights is the leader of a Canadian finance shared service center of excellence that centralizes the transactional and reporting capabilities to provide ongoing support to our Finance teams. It also operationalizes capabilities transformed by the finance transformation programs.

The role is in close relationship with international finance, the technology department, the two commercial finance divisions as well as the corporate finance function.”
